Summary
Autonomous AI agents — tools that can take actions, not just answer questions — are moving from demos into real business use. Companies are already using agents to triage customer requests, update CRM records, run routine analyses, and create automated reports. That shift is making automation more flexible: instead of one-off scripts, agents can coordinate multiple systems, ask for clarifications, and learn repeatable workflows.
Why this matters for business
– Faster execution: Agents cut manual steps across sales, ops, and support, saving time and reducing errors.
– Smarter automation: They combine data, process rules, and LLM reasoning to handle exceptions rather than failing silently.
– Better reporting: Agents can pull data from several sources, reconcile it, and produce clear, contextual reports for decision-makers.
– Competitive edge: Early adopters improve efficiency and responsiveness without hiring large teams.

Here’s how your business can take advantage without guessing or breaking systems:
1. Start with a business problem, not the tech
– Pick a high-value, repeatable workflow: sales follow-ups, monthly pipeline health checks, expense reconciliation, or SLA triage.
2. Run a short, controlled pilot
– Define a 4–8 week pilot with clear success metrics (time saved, error reduction, revenue influenced).
– Use human-in-the-loop controls while the agent learns.
3. Connect data safely
– Integrate agents with your CRM, ERP, and reporting systems using least-privilege access and logging.
– Use retrieval-augmented generation (RAG) for accurate answers from internal docs.
4. Design guardrails and monitoring
– Set approval gates, audit trails, and escalation paths.
– Track performance and drift with regular reviews.
5. Measure ROI and scale
– Translate time savings and increased pipeline coverage into dollar impact.
– Expand agents into adjacent processes once governance and results are proven.
